🔹Understand the Arizona Market First
Arizona’s real estate market is dynamic and varies by city. In 2025, metro areas like Phoenix, Chandler, and Mesa are showing signs of normalization. That means there’s a shift from a seller’s market toward a more balanced one. Understanding local supply and demand will help you time your sale and price it correctly. 🔹What Buyers Want in Arizona Right Now
Arizona homebuyers today are focused on value, energy efficiency, and location. Features like solar panels, newer AC units, and updated kitchens matter more than ever. If your home offers these, highlight them. If not, consider low-cost upgrades to improve appeal.

🔹Prepare Your Home to Stand Out
Decluttering, deep cleaning, and staging your home can significantly boost first impressions. In Arizona, outdoor spaces like patios and pools are big selling points. Don’t overlook curb appeal—clean landscaping and a fresh coat of paint go a long way.

🔹Legal Obligations and Arizona Disclosures
You’re required to disclose any known issues with the property using the Arizona Seller Property Disclosure Statement (SPDS). Not doing so can result in legal trouble later. Long Le walks you through the process so you’re covered.
🔹Should You Offer Buyer Incentives?
Depending on the market, offering incentives like closing cost assistance or a home warranty can attract more buyers. It’s a strategic tool—not a weakness—especially when inventory rises.
